Disability Insurance: A Safety Net for Unexpected Challenges
Life abruptly throws curveballs, and when a health crisis or accident strikes, it can severely disrupt your ability to work. That's where disability insurance comes in as a vital safety net. This type of coverage provides economic support if you become unable to perform your job duties due to an illness, injury, or other qualifying condition. It can help reduce the stress of medical bills, living expenses, and other obligations. By securing disability insurance, you're essentially investing in your peace of mind, ensuring that you and your family can weather life's challenges with greater stability.
- Evaluate the level of coverage that best accommodates your needs and financial situation
- Compare different disability insurance providers to find a policy that offers favorable terms
- Examine the policy's details carefully before signing to coverage

Coverage for You and Your Family
Securing reliable health insurance is an imperative step in protecting the well-being of you and your family. Unforeseen medical bills can rapidly become a budgetary burden, leaving you stressed. With health insurance, you gain comfort of mind knowing that treatment costs are covered.
A good health insurance plan provides protection for a wide range of procedures, including doctor's visits, hospitalization, medications, and first aid. Selecting the right program depends on your individual needs and expenses.
- Compare different health insurance choices available in your area.
- Consider factors such as benefits, premiums, and deductibles.
- Talk with an insurance advisor to get personalized guidance.
